To enhance the security of your uPVC windows You can install locks to the handle or an extra lock to the bottom of your door. This will prevent a burglar from opening the window by lifting the handle. You can also install a sash lock that keeps the window from being opened if the door is forced open.

You can also put up security grilles to protect your windows. These are an effective security measure against burglars because they are tough to smash through and will not obstruct your view. They are an excellent choice for period houses because they blend in with the other features of your house.
